Grid Metals Corp V.GRDM

Alternate Symbol(s):  MSMGF

Grid Metals Corp. explores for and develops base and precious metal mineral properties in Canada. It explores for nickel, copper, cobalt, lithium, cesium, palladium, and platinum group metals. Grid Metals Corp. is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

Biden’s Inflation Reduction Act

Biden’s Inflation Reduction Act       The market hasn’t sorted this out yet, but the IFA could have a major impact on North American miners. The requirement that EV batteries have locally (North American) sourced materials within the next two years, to qualify for the $7500 tax credit, will have battery manufactures scrambling to secure locally-sourced EV minerals (graphite, lithium, copper, nickel, cobalt, etc). Grid’s Makwa/Mayville Ni/Cu project and associated Donner Li project could now fall under a whole new light, considering that these are currently being rejigged as smaller scale mining operations that could be fast-tracked, because they won’t require federal involvement in the permitting process. Things could get interesting for Grid this fall and ya gotta love the amount of leverage in this one.
